> > Okay, folks... sorry for the delay in getting this sent out.
> >
> > Please try the attached comx.xml file (replace the one
> currently in Program
> > Files\Quick Search Deskbar\searches\ ) and let me know how
> it works for you
> > (a reply on this list with "it works" is sufficient).  If
> something isn't
> > working quite right, obviously, let me know that as well.  ;)
> >
> > If things seem to be in order, I'll ask Monty or Kim to commit it to
> > trunk...
> >
> > 09Nov08 changes:
> >        o  www.comics.com restructured their site.  changed
> default behavior
> > to accommodate.
> >        o  several comics no longer offered at comics.com.
> removed from the
> > list
> >        o  "Dilbert" comic now hosted at dilbert.com.  added
> new site,
> > 'dilbert' to accommodate.
> >        o  "Peanuts" comic no longer requires special handling from
> > comics.com.  changed back to 'standard' handling method
> >        o  added "Boy on a Stick and Slither", "Brevity",
> and "Cow & Boy"
> > comics.
> >        o  Please let me know if there are other
> comics.com-hosted comic
> > strips you'd like added
